Tripura’s Seasonal Weather Patterns
To make the most of your visit to Tripura, it’s essential to know the seasonal weather patterns. The state’s climate varies significantly across different seasons, impacting the overall travel experience.
Summer Season
Summer in Tripura, from March to May, is characterized by rising temperatures. The temperature can soar, making it less ideal for outdoor activities. It’s a period of relatively low rainfall, but the heat can be quite intense.
Monsoon Season
The monsoon season brings significant rainfall to Tripura from June to September. While the rain can make the landscapes lush and green, it might hinder some travel plans. The climate becomes humid, and the weather can be quite unpredictable.
Winter Season
Winter, from October to February, is considered the best time to visit Tripura. The weather is cool and pleasant, with temperatures ranging between 10°C and 30°C. It’s an ideal period for engaging in various outdoor activities like picnics and camping.
Season | Months | Characteristics |
---|---|---|
Summer | March to May | High temperatures, low rainfall |
Monsoon | June to September | High rainfall, humid climate |
Winter | October to February | Cool and pleasant weather, ideal for outdoor activities |

Prime Time: November to February
The winter season, from November to February, is considered the best time to visit Tripura. During these months, the temperature ranges between 10°C and 30°C, making it ideal for tourists to explore the state’s attractions without the discomfort of extreme weather. The pleasant weather conditions during this period make it perfect for travel and outdoor activities.
Shoulder Season Options: October and March
For those who prefer fewer crowds, the shoulder season months of October and March are worth considering. The weather during these months is relatively pleasant, with moderate temperatures. It’s a good time to visit if you’re looking for a more relaxed experience and lower prices.
What to Pack Based on When You Visit
Understanding what to pack is crucial for a comfortable trip. Here’s a quick guide:
Season | Months | Packing Essentials |
---|---|---|
Summer | March to May | Lightweight, breathable clothing, sun protection (hats, sunglasses, sunscreen) |
Monsoon | June to September | Waterproof essentials (umbrellas, rain jackets, waterproof footwear) |
Winter | November to February | Layers for temperature variations (light sweaters, jackets) |
Regardless of when you visit, it’s always a good idea to pack comfortable walking shoes, modest clothing for religious sites, and basic medications. This preparation will ensure you’re ready for the trip and can enjoy the various places Tripura has to offer.
